hudahua

所在地区: 全国
首页
服务/硬件产品
行业解决方案
案例
12232/12864 Linux驱动_百工联_工业互联网技术服务平台
12232/12864 Linux驱动
全国
浏览
-
hudahua
方案概述:

我们提供了一个解决方案来实现12232/12864 Linux驱动。首先,确定硬件平台为ARM9(S3C2440)。然后,编写驱动程序,包括初始化、设置显示模式和控制亮度等功能。接下来,将驱动程序集成到Linux内核中。为了验证驱动的正确性和稳定性,编写测试程序来控制点阵屏显示不同的内容。最后,进行调试和优化工作,提高驱动程序的效率和稳定性。通过这些步骤,我们可以在ARM9(S3C2440)平台上使用点阵屏,并通过驱动程序控制其显示内容和参数。

解决方案:

为了实现12232/12864 Linux驱动,我们可以采用以下步骤:

1. 确定硬件平台:在ARM9(S3C2440)上实现点阵屏驱动,需要先确定硬件平台。ARM9(S3C2440)是一款常用的嵌入式处理器,具有较高的性能和稳定性,适合用于驱动点阵屏。

2. 编写驱动程序:根据点阵屏的规格和接口要求,编写相应的驱动程序。这包括初始化点阵屏、设置显示模式、控制点阵屏的亮度和对比度等功能。在编写驱动程序时,需要参考点阵屏的数据手册和硬件平台的相关文档。

3. 集成到Linux内核:将编写好的驱动程序集成到Linux内核中。这可以通过修改内核配置文件、添加驱动源代码文件等方式实现。集成到内核后,可以通过加载驱动模块或重新编译内核的方式启用点阵屏驱动。

4. 编写测试程序:为了验证点阵屏驱动的正确性和稳定性,需要编写相应的测试程序。测试程序可以通过控制点阵屏显示不同的图案、文字等内容,以及测试点阵屏的响应速度和刷新率等功能。测试程序可以使用C语言或其他编程语言编写,并与点阵屏驱动进行交互。

5. 调试和优化:在完成驱动程序和测试程序的编写后,需要进行调试和优化工作。通过调试工具和技术,检查驱动程序的运行状态和输出结果,解决可能存在的问题和错误。同时,根据实际需求和性能要求,对驱动程序进行优化,提高其效率和稳定性。

通过以上步骤,我们可以实现12232/12864 Linux驱动。这样,我们就可以在ARM9(S3C2440)平台上使用点阵屏,并通过驱动程序控制点阵屏的显示内容和参数。同时,通过编写测试程序,可以验证驱动程序的正确性和稳定性,确保点阵屏的正常工作。
为您推荐其他供应商的行业解决方案
免责声明:本网站部分内容来源互联网,如权利人发现存在侵权信息,请及时与本站联系删除。
供应商:
hudahua
所在区域: 全国
Hudahua是一家专注于嵌入式开发的公司,拥有丰富的经验和技术实力。我们的核心能力包括ARM、Linux、ucos(STM32)、QT_Linux和zigbee等领域。我们的团队在嵌入式开发方面拥有深厚的技术积累,能够为客户提供全方位的解决方案。 作为一家专业的嵌入式开发公司,我们的产品和解决方案广泛应用于各个行业。我们的产品包括12232和12864 Linux驱动,能够满足客户在显示设备方面的需求。我们的解决方案涵盖了多个领域,包括工业控制、智能家居、物联网等。 我们的团队致力于为客户提供高质量的产品和解决方案。我们注重技术创新和质量控制,确保我们的产品能够满足客户的需求。我们的团队成员都具备丰富的经验和专业知识,能够为客户提供专业的咨询和技术支持。 在过去的项目中,我们与众多客户合作,取得了良好的成果。我们的解决方案得到了客户的认可和赞赏,为客户提供了可靠的技术支持。我们将继续努力,不断提升自身的技术实力和服务水平,为客户提供更好的产品和解决方案。 如果您对嵌入式开发领域有需求,Hudahua将是您的理想合作伙伴。我们将竭诚为您提供优质的产品和专业的服务,与您共同实现成功。